A British judge has recently ordered him to remain in custody while he faces allegations of assault against music producer Abe Diaw. The incident occurred at a London nightclub in February 2023, and the shocking details have raised eyebrows across the music industry.<\/p>\n<h2>The Assault Allegations<\/h2>\n<p>In a court session at <strong>Manchester Magistrates\u2019 Court<\/strong>, Brown, aged 36, faced a charge of causing grievous bodily harm. The judge, <strong>Joanne Hirst<\/strong>, denied his bail request after prosecutor <strong>Hannah Nicholls<\/strong> emphasized the seriousness of the crime. According to Nicholls, Brown allegedly attacked Diaw without provocation, using a bottle as a weapon.<\/p>\n<p>The confrontation was reportedly captured on <strong>surveillance camera<\/strong>, documenting the extent of the violence. Brown was said to have chased Diaw, inflicting punches and kicks in front of an audience at the Tape nightclub, situated in the upscale Mayfair district of London. This incident serves as a grim reminder of the singer&#8217;s turbulent past and raises concerns about his behavior both off and on stage.<\/p>\n<h2>Upcoming Tour at Risk<\/h2>\n<p>Brown\u2019s current legal challenges cast a shadow on his much-anticipated international tour, which was set to commence soon. Following his appearance in court, he is scheduled to face another hearing on <strong>June 13<\/strong> in London, coinciding with the third date of his tour in <strong>Frankfurt, Germany<\/strong>. This overlapping schedule creates uncertainty regarding his ability to perform. Furthermore, he has a significant performance lined up on <strong>August 8<\/strong> at Ford Field in Detroit.<\/p>\n<h2>The Defense&#8217;s Argument<\/h2>\n<p>While the prosecution portrayed the incident as extremely severe, Brown\u2019s defense attorney, <strong>Grace Forbes<\/strong>, contended that he poses no threat of fleeing the country and should be granted bail. However, Judge Hirst ruled against this request, suggesting that the gravity of the charges necessitated precautionary measures.<\/p>\n<h2>Chris Brown&#8217;s Distinctive Persona<\/h2>\n<p>Wearing sweatpants and a black T-shirt and accompanied by court officers, Brown\u2019s appearance seemed somewhat casual despite the serious allegations against him. During the hearing, he confirmed his identity and provided the address of his temporary residence, the local Lowry Hotel, where he was arrested shortly before his court appearance.<\/p>\n<h2>A Complicated Career<\/h2>\n<p>Chris Brown, often referred to by his nickname <strong>Breezy<\/strong>, has had a tumultuous career since his debut as a teenager in 2005. Known for chart-topping hits like \u201cRun It,\u201d \u201cKiss Kiss,\u201d and \u201cWithout You,\u201d he has solidified his status as a significant figure in the music industry. Despite his successes, including two Grammy awards\u2014his first for the best R&#038;B album \u201cF.A.M.E.\u201d in 2011 and his second for \u201c11:11 (Deluxe)\u201d earlier this year\u2014Brown&#8217;s career has been marred by various controversies.<\/p>\n<h2>The Impact of Ongoing Controversies<\/h2>\n<p>This latest incident may have far-reaching effects on Brown&#8217;s career trajectory. His upcoming tour includes collaborations with notable artists such as <strong>Jhene Aiko<\/strong>, <strong>Summer Walker<\/strong>, and <strong>Bryson Tiller<\/strong>. The European leg is slated to begin on <strong>June 8<\/strong> in <strong>Amsterdam<\/strong>, followed by North American performances in July.
